摘要
目的采用RNA干扰技术特异性阻断前列腺癌细胞PC-3中Aurora-A的表达,观察其对肿瘤细胞生长的抑制作用。方法采用免疫组化方法检测Aurora-A在前列腺癌细胞中的表达。体外化学合成特异针对Aurora-A基因的小干扰RNA(small interfering RNA,siRNA),以脂质体转染前列腺癌细胞系PC-3,荧光显微镜及流式细胞仪确定最佳转染效率。MTT法检测细胞增殖抑制率,流式细胞仪检测细胞凋亡率。RT-PCR和Western-blot检测Aurora-A mRNA和蛋白的表达。结果 Aurora-A蛋白主要表达于PC-3细胞胞浆中;脂质体的最佳转染效率高于90%;siR-NA1组24h、48h、72h细胞增殖抑制率分别为(0.377±0.035)%、(0.597±0.065)%、(0.749±0.061)%,与各组比较均有显著性差异;siRNA1组细胞凋亡率为(50.593±1.208)%,与各组比较均有显著性差异;RT-PCR检测siRNA1组Aurora-A mRNA相对值为(1.354±0.087),与各组比较均有显著性差异;Western-blot检测显示siRNA 1组蛋白表达量明显低于对照组。结论应用RNAi技术靶向沉默Aurora-A基因可以下调Aurora-A mRNA及蛋白的表达,抑制细胞增殖,促进细胞凋亡。
Objective To observe the inhibition of prostate cancer cell PC-3 by RNA interference on Aurora-A oncogene. Methods The expression of Aurora-A in prostate cancer cell was detected by immunohis- tochemical staining. The small interference RNAs(siRNAs) for Aurora-A oncogene was designed and synthesized in vitro, and was transfected into prostate cancer cell PC-3 by liposome. The transfection efficiency was detected by fluorescence microscope and flow cytometer. The cell inhibition rate was measured by MTT assay and apoptosis rate was measured by flow cytometer. The expression of Aurora-A protein and the expressions of Aurora-A mRNA were detected separately by the western blot and RT-PCR. Results Most Aurora-A proteins were found in the PC-3 cytoplasm. The transfection efficiency was more than90%. The 24th-hour, 48th-hour and 72th inhibition rates in siRNA1 group were ( -hour cell 0. 377 ± 0.035) %. (0. 597 ± 0. 065) % and(0. 749 ± 0. 061 ) % respectively. When it was compared with others groups, there were obvious difference. The RT-PCR detection showed that the relative value of Aurora-A mRNA was (1. 354±0. 087), there were also obviously difference between the siRNA1 group and other groups. The expression of Aurora-A protein was obviously lower than in the control group. Conclusion RNA interference for Aurora-A oncogene can reduce the expression of Aurora-A mRNA and protein, inhibit cell prolif- eration and induce cell apoptosis.
